Care and Maintenance
Service
Regular servicing by a Sartorius
technician will extend the service life of
your scale and ensure its continued
weighing accuracy. Sartorius can offer
you service contracts, with your choice
of regular maintenance intervals ranging
from 6 months to 2 years.
Repairs
! Do not open the YPS03-X... AC
adapter (power supply) while it is
carrying current. Wait at least 1
minute after disconnecting it from
power before beginning to open the
AC adapter (power supply). Proper
fitting of all surfaces is essential for
safe operation of the device; for this
reason the device must be opened
and closed by a certified technician.
Use care in removing and replacing
the screws, because scratches on
the AC adapter (power supply) void
the Ex-approval rating.
! A defective AC adapter (power
supply) must be disconnected from
power immediately. Repair work
must be performed by authorized
Sartorius service technicians using
original spare parts. Any attempt
by untrained persons to perform
repairs may result in considerable
hazards for the user.
! If a cable or cable connector is
defective or damaged, replace the
entire cable as a single unit.
Cleaning
! Unplug the AC adapter from the
wall outlet (mains supply). If you
have a data cable connected to
the interface, unplug it from the
scale.
! Make sure that no dust or liquid
enters the scale housing
! Do not use any aggressive
cleaning agents (solvents or similar
agents)
§ Clean the scale using a piece of
cloth which has been slightly
dampened with naphtha or
alcohol
§ Carefully remove any sample
residue/spilled powder by using a
brush or a hand-held vacuum
cleaner
! Do not wash down the equipment
with water or dry it with
compressed air; this is not
permitted.
Cleaning the Dust Cover
! Clean the dust cover outside the
hazardous area or location only
! Do not use a dry cloth to wipe off
or rub the dust cover
$ After cleaning, discharge the dust
cover to remove static electricity;
for example, wipe all surfaces with
a moistened and grounded cloth.
